MATCH OF THE DAY HIGHLIGHTS: CPD Y Rhyl 1879 3 Holyhead Hotspur 4

MATCH HIGHLIGHTS

CPD Y Rhyl 1879 3 (D Proctor 33 & 64, Reynolds 84)
Holyhead Hotspur 4 (T Owen pen 71, C Williams 74 & 88, S Murphy 78)

20 min: Hotspur’s Kyle Murphy is fortunate to escape with a yellow card for a high challenge on Calum Proctor

26 min: Rhyl’s Dylan Proctor runs into the box, lets fly with left-foot screamer but Guto Hughes brilliantly tips over

31 min: Proctor latches onto poor back-pass but is denied by Hughes, who is quick to close him down

33 min – GOAL: At last the Lilywhites edge ahead. Good cross from Lewis Hodson is converted into a goal by DYLAN PROCTOR’S diving header. RHYL 1 HOTSPUR 0

39 min: Hughes makes a double save. Firstly, he gets his body behind a Paul Fleming free kick, the ball balloons into the air and Tom Kemp meets full force on the volley but the keeper saves magnificently.

HALF-TIME: Rhyl 1 Hotspur 0

51 min: Reece Fairhurst blasts a free kick just wide for hosts.

58 min: Dylan Proctor’s volley on the turn misses by inches

62 min: Jamie McDaid makes Rhyl debut, replacing Hodson

64 min – GOAL: Sloppy defending from Hotspur. DYLAN PROCTOR nips in ahead of Tomos Owen and runs clear before sliding the ball past Hughes for his 28th goal of the season. RHYL 2 HOTSPUR 0

69 min – Three substitutions by Hotspur change the game: Cory Williams, Jacob Godsman-Pilling and Shay Murphy replace Kane Roberts, Ifan Emlyn Jones and Kenleigh Owen.

71 min – PENALTY: Cory Williams is tripped in the area and Hotspur score from their very first effort on target. TOMOS OWEN converts from the spot.

74 min – GOAL: Holyhead are now a team transformed. CORY WILLIAMS applies a close range finish to make it 2-2.

78 min – GOAL: James Phillips sends over an amazing cross from the right and sub SHAY MURPHY slots home at the back post. RHYL 2 HOTSPUR 3 – unbelievable!

84 min – GOAL: Rhyl pour forward. Calum Proctor crosses high from the right and SAM REYNOLDS heads home. RHYL 3 HOTSPUR 3

88 min – GOAL: Hotspur grab the winner. Corner is swung over from the left, the ball is headed back across goal at the rear stick by Tomos Owen and CORY WILLIAMS finds the net. Four shots, four goals in a 17-minute period from the visitors. RHYL 3 HOTSPUR 4

90 min+: Yellow card for Hotspur keeper Hughes after he pushes the ball away to waste time when a Rhyl player throws it to him.

FULL-TIME: Rhyl 1879 3 Holyhead Hotspur 4
